What is Widescreen Fix for Old Games and Why Is It Important

A “widescreen fix for old games” is a simple way to make older games work better on modern screens. Back in the day, games were designed for smaller, square-shaped monitors. This means when you try to play them today, they look blurry or stretched. A widescreen fix changes the game’s display settings to match widescreen monitors, which are much wider.

A proper widescreen fix makes the game visuals sharper and fits correctly with your screen. This is especially important if you’re playing on newer devices or high-resolution monitors. No more messing with settings, just plug and play with better graphics.

How to Install a Widescreen Fix for Old Games Easily

Installing a widescreen fix for old games is usually quick and easy. First, you’ll need to find a reliable mod or patch. You can find these on websites that specialize in gaming mods or fan communities. Once you’ve found your fix, download the file to your computer.

Steps to Install:

  • Download the widescreen fix mod or patch for the game you want to fix.
  • Extract the files and place them in the game’s main directory folder.
  • Follow the instructions to modify the game’s graphics settings.
  • Run the game and check if the widescreen fix is working. If not, restart the game.

If you’re not sure how to install, there are tutorials available online, or even helpful YouTube videos that guide you through the process.

Common Issues with Widescreen Fixes in Old Games & How to Solve Them

Even though applying a widescreen fix for old games is usually easy, sometimes it doesn’t work as expected. There are a few problems that gamers can run into, such as distorted visuals or crashes. Don’t worry—there are solutions!

Common Problems:

  • Graphics Glitching: Some old games have odd stretching effects even with a widescreen fix. If this happens, check for updates or patches for your tool.
  • Black Bars Still Showing: If you still see black bars on the sides, make sure you’ve applied the fix properly. Try downloading another fix or tweak your screen resolution settings.
  • The Game Doesn’t Start After Fix: This can happen with older tools or patches. Always make sure your game files are backed up, and look for a new mod to replace the one causing issues.
